Receive notifications when the one-way …One-Way Interview Instructions. Once you enter your interview, you'll be taken through a few steps before recording your answers. First, you'll watch a quick intro video. Next, you'll get walked through setting up your webcam and microphone. A one-way interview consists of you answering a series of pre-recorded questions in your own time and in your own space. Unlike a traditional phone or video interview, one-way interviewing lacks the conventional conversation that you may be used to.
